WebFor antibiotic treatment of an infected human bite in children, the first-choice oral antibiotic for those aged 1 month and over is co-amoxiclav for 5 days: 1 month to 11 months: 0.25 … Web11 Feb 2024 · If someone cuts his or her knuckles on another person's teeth, as might happen in a fight, this is also considered a human bite. And a cut on the knuckles from your own teeth, such as from a fall, is considered a human bite. To take care of a human bite that breaks the skin: Stop the bleeding by applying pressure with a clean, dry cloth.

WebHuman scabies is caused by an infestation of the skin by the human itch mite (Sarcoptes scabiei var. hominis). The microscopic scabies mite burrows into the upper layer of the skin where it lives and lays its eggs. The most common symptoms of scabies are intense itching and a pimple-like skin rash. Seymour Fractures are displaced distal phalangeal physeal fractures with an associated nailbed injury.
